Kawasaki 1400GTR onwers of from the GTR Onwer Club (GTROC) begun their 6thgathering today in the historic city of Melaka.
Some 50 owners of the high-powered sport-tourer congregated at Kawasaki Motors (Malaysia) Sdn. Bhd.’s (KMMSB) compound for the flag off. From there, they rode to Ayer Keroh, Melaka to meet up with another group of 1400GTR owners, bring the total to almost 300 motorcycles.
The group will visit an orphanage and a religious school for charity work, as part of the ride’s itinerary.
The Assistant General Manager of KMMSB, En. Awaluddin Bin Md. Lip, and Assistant Manager for Marketing of KMMSB, En. Ahmad Radzi Abdul Rahman (better known as Che Mad) welcomed the group. They added that KMMSB felt honoured to support the group and their activities, besides looking forward to more co-operations in the future.
President of GTROC, Dato’ Shaid Tasiran thanked KMMSB for their support. He then laid down the rules for the convoy, including the etiquettes such as following the marshals’ signals, no wild riding, etc., besides their itinerary and routes.
The Royal Malaysian Traffic Police will escort the group once they reached Melaka.
The ride was flagged off by En. Awaluddin Bin Md. Lip.
The event began with Chia Motor PJ’s proprietor, Keith Chia thanking the sponsors and contributors to the team. It started with Dato’ Jeffery Lim, General Manager and Director of Kawasaki Motor (Malaysia) Sdn. Bhd. Keith mentioned that Kawasaki Malaysia had been instrumental the team’s success throughout the years. Indeed, the Kawasaki Ninja ZX-10R was the weapon on which Azlan Shah destroyed the competition.
Next up was Kratos Motorsports Sdn. Bhd. who are the official distributor of K-Tech suspension systems in Malaysia. Kratos works hand-in-hand with Chia Motor PJ to supply K-Tech suspension solutions to motorcycle owners who demand the best in suspension technology and handling from their bikes. Azlan Shah’s racebike was fitted with K-Tech suspension components, consequently.
An award of appreciation was also handed to Bikes Republic and Moto Malaya as we covered the team’s journey through the entire 2018 Pirelli Malaysia Superbike Championship season. It was a real honour observing the professionalism of the team in carrying out their duties. Managing Editor Keshy Dillon received the award from Keith Chia.
Next up was Mr. Edmund Lim, the Director of Octo Galaxy Sdn. Bhd. Octo Galaxy is the official distributor Eurol Lubricant and products. Eurol sponsors the lubricants used in the team’s Kawasaki Ninja ZX-10R.
Lastly, a special appreciation award was handed to Azlan Shah Kamaruzaman. Keith was full of respect for the rider MSBK lap record when he qualified on pole for the two final rounds. His lap of 2:07.708s was only 2 seconds away from the times recorded in the full-blown World Superbike Championship round at SIC.
Keith also iterated on how proud he is to be a Malaysian for having a team consisting of all races and religions working together to achieve the highest accolades.
Scores of Kawasaki owners showed up for the evening, too, despite the heavy rain.
The night continued with dinner, a live band and lucky draws.

Fancy test riding your dream Kawasaki? The Kawasaki Test Ride Roadshow, dubbed Close to You, will visit Kedah from 1st December 2017 (Friday) until 3rd December 2017 (Sunday). The event will be held at the parking lot of Amanjaya Mall, Sungai Petani, from 10am to 6pm.
This is your best opportunity to test ride the wide range of Kawasaki’s superbike models, which include the fun and go-anywhere Versys-X 250, the high performance and fierce-looking Z900 Special Edition ABS, the revolutionary-styles Z650 ABS and the quick yet rider-friendly Ninja 650 ABS. The Kawasaki Test Ride Roadshow aims to share the unique experience of the performance, comfort and versatility of Kawasaki’s motorcycles firsthand with the general public. Who knows, you may discover a bike that best fits your style and be amazed by its performance.
As with all Kawasaki Motors Malaysia’s (KMBS) programs, safety is the highest priority. Hence, riders must be aged 18 years and above, holds a valid motorcycle license. Please be dressed in long pants and closed shoes (slippers and sandals are not allowed) should you wish to test ride the bikes.
Each rider who test rode the bikes will also receive a lucky draw coupon (valid only for the corresponding day of the event) for a chance to win exciting prizes.
Apart from the test rides, KMSB has lined up many activities that will surely appeal to every visitor.
KMSB will also display a number of Kawasaki superbikes including a replica of the World Superbike Championship (WSBK) winning ZX-10R. It’s racing sister ZX-10R had won the WSBK in 2013, 2015 and 2016. (Kawasaki had also won the 2017 WSBK title but the replica is not present yet.) KMSB will also display the world’s fastest production motorcycle – the supercharged Kawasaki H2 – which has hit 400 km/h.
Besides that, Kawasaki superbike owners will enjoy the luxury of having their pride and joy inspected and services during the event. Highly trained Kawasaki Exclusive Service Centre (KESC) personnel will provide free consultation and advice.

Looking for a Kawasaki group to join? Here are some of the top Kawasaki motorcycle clubs in Malaysia.
Some of the most active Kawasaki groups in the country are the Kawasaki Owners Group (KOG), Wilhin Motor Group and Welly Advance Bikers.
Other honourable mentions are the Kawasaki Lady Bikers, Z800 HaVoC, ZX-6R / ZX-10R Community Malaysia, Z250 Malaysia, Z900 Malaysia Owners and many more.
